FAQ: How is the puzzle-seed vault for Gridlewick recovered after a lockout?

The Gridlewick crossword generator derives its daily puzzle seeds from a sealed vault; three failed unseal attempts trigger a lockout. For your review: recovery does not bypass auditing — every unseal attempt is logged to the Thornbury audit stream with operator identity and timestamp. To reproduce the recovery path in your test environment, unseal the vault using the passphrase printed below.

unlock words, kawig-fawig: frawyn-soriel-ralok-casdor-sorwyn-casdor-novdor-kasvan-siliel-aldath-feniel-ulaath-zorwyn

## TimeLoom Solver — Release Access

TimeLoom generates conflict-free timetables for the Bracken Hollow school district pilot. Releases are cut from the stable branch every second Thursday; the solver's constraint files are versioned alongside the binary and must ship together. As release manager, you hold the signing account for build artifacts. If that account locks during a release window, use the offline recovery flow rather than waiting for support. The recovery passphrase appears below.

strongbox words: zormir-quenath-sorax

The Gatewick internal API gateway enforces per-tenant rate limits sourced from our contract with Quillbridge Systems. Current ceiling: 1,200 req/min per service token. Release builds that add new upstream calls must declare expected QPS in the release checklist; Quillbridge bills overages quarterly. Do not raise limits via config overrides — that breaches the vendor agreement. Limit-increase requests need two business days' notice. Send contract or quota questions to the vendor liaison at the address below.

pager mailbox: druwyn@norvaio.corp

- [ ] **Step 7: Breaker override escrow.** After sealing the signing keys for the Tallgrove upstream API circuit breaker, confirm the support team can force the breaker open during a full outage. The override bundle lives in the sealed escrow drawer and is useless without its unlock phrase. Two ceremony witnesses must initial this step before proceeding. The escrow bundle is decrypted with the recovery passphrase that follows.

vault phrase of kahip-kahop = holath-quenmir